The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of James Edwards, born in 1825 in Cranleigh, Surrey, consisted of 5 members. James was the head of the household, married to Lucy Edwards, born in 1833 in Edenbridge, Kent, England. They had 2 children; Annie (born 1859 in Edenbridge, Kent, England) and Albert (born 1861 in Edenbridge, Kent, England).
During the period, also present in the household was James's Boarder, Henry Jenner, born in 1855 in Cowden, Kent, England.
